It is also available here: * @see: http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0.txt * * Any republication or derived work distributed in source code form * must include this copyright and license notice. */ package compbio.engine; import compbio.engine.client.ConfiguredExecutable; import compbio.metadata.JobStatus; import compbio.metadata.JobSubmissionException; import compbio.metadata.ResultNotAvailableException; /** * An asynchronous executor engine, capable of running, cancelling, * obtaining results calculated by a native executable wrapper in Executable interface. * Implementation agnostic. Executables can be run either locally to the JVM or on the cluster. * * @author pvtroshin * Date October 2009 */ public interface AsyncExecutor { /** * Submits job for the execution * Immediate execution is not guaranteed, this method puts the job in the queue. * All it guarantees that the job will be eventually executed. * The start of execution will depend on the number of jobs in the queue. * * @return unique job identifier * @throws JobSubmissionException * if submission fails. This usually happens due to the problem on a server side. */ String submitJob(ConfiguredExecutable executable) throws JobSubmissionException; /** * Retrieve the results of the job. Please not that current implementations of this method * blocks if the task is running until the end of the calculation. * * @param jobId job identifier obtained at the job submission * @return ConfiguredExecutable object from which result can be obtained * @throws ResultNotAvailableException if the result is not available for whatever reason. * Could be due to execution failure, or due to the results being removed from the server at * the time of request. */ ConfiguredExecutable getResults(String jobId) throws ResultNotAvailableException; /** * * @param jobId unique job identifier * @return task working directory */ String getWorkDirectory(String jobId); /** * Remove all files and a job directory for a jobid. * @param jobId * @return true if job directory was successfully removed, false otherwise. */ boolean cleanup(String jobId); /** * Stop running job. Please not that this method does not guarantee to remove the job directory and files in it. * * @return true if job was cancelled successfully, false otherwise */ boolean cancelJob(String jobId); /** * Query the status of the job * @param String * jobId - unique job identifier * @return The JobStatus object representing the status of the job * @see JobStatus */ JobStatus getJobStatus(String jobId); }
